What to look for before you rent
Paddle quality varies a lot between venues. Ask whether the paddles are entry-level wood or composite, and whether they're maintained (grips replaced, no cracked faces, honest paddle weight). Check what's included in the rental fee: balls, court time, or just the paddle. Confirm availability during peak evening and weekend slots, since popular venues run out of loaner paddles fast. It's also worth asking if they offer different paddle weights or grip sizes, since a mismatched paddle affects your swing more than most beginners expect.
